The Pennsylvania Department of Transportation (PennDOT) is planning temporary nighttime closures are expected on Interstate 90 next week as work continues on the demolition of the bridge that carries Jordan Road over the highway in Harborcreek Township. 

According to PennDOT, drivers should anticipate slowdowns and stopped traffic between Exit 32 (route 430/290, Wesleyville/Bayfront Connector) and Exit 29 (Route 8, Hammett/Parade Street) nightly from 8 p.m. to 8 a.m. on April 14, 2025 to April 25, 2025. 

Rolling closures will be used as needed as needed as crews remove the beams of the bridge.
